哪些情况下阿里云虚拟主机会CPU受限怎么解决?

云计算服务广泛应用的今天,阿里云虚拟主机作为企业建站和业务部署的重要选择,其性能稳定性直接影响用户体验和业务连续性。CPU作为虚拟主机的核心计算资源,一旦出现使用率过高或性能受限的情况,将导致网站访问延迟、服务中断等严重后果。本文将系统分析导致CPU资源受限的关键因素,并提供切实可行的优化方案。

哪些情况下阿里云虚拟主机会CPU受限怎么解决?

进程与线程资源过度占用

当虚拟主机上运行的应用程序配置不当或存在恶意软件时,会产生过多的进程和线程,这会直接导致CPU资源被过度占用。特别是在多线程操作频繁的场景下,所有处理能力可能被耗尽,对虚拟主机进程产生显著的负面影响。

  • 解决方案:通过优化应用程序配置,减少不必要的进程和线程数量,调整应用程序的优先级设置。
  • 检测方法:使用系统监控工具分析进程资源占用情况,识别异常进程。
  • 预防措施:定期进行安全扫描,防止恶意软件入侵,同时对应用程序进行负载测试。

多用户环境下的资源争抢问题

在多台虚拟主机共享同一网络资源的环境下,当某个主机的CPU占用率异常升高时,其他主机可能受到连带影响。这种资源争抢现象尤其容易在网络拥塞、带宽不足或网络设备配置不当时发生。

问题类型 表现特征 影响范围
网络带宽争抢 数据传输速率下降 同一网络段所有主机
CPU周期分配不均 任务处理延迟增加 单个虚拟主机
存储I/O竞争 读写操作响应缓慢 依赖同一存储的主机

优化建议:通过调整网络配置,增加带宽资源,优化网络设备参数,并采用负载均衡技术分散网络负载。对于重要业务,可考虑升级为独享云虚拟主机,确保资源分配的独立性。

硬件故障导致的性能异常

虽然虚拟化环境降低了硬件依赖,但底层物理硬件的故障仍会直接影响虚拟主机的CPU性能。内存条损坏、硬盘故障或电源供应不稳定都可能导致CPU占用率异常升高。

硬件故障具有隐蔽性,通常需要通过系统监控工具的异常指标来间接发现。例如,当磁盘延迟持续高于10毫秒时,可能表明存储设备存在健康问题。

针对硬件问题,建议定期检查服务器硬件状态,及时更换损坏组件。对于关键业务系统,应采用高可用架构,确保单点故障不影响整体服务连续性。

配置不当与资源分配不合理

虚拟主机的初始配置如果不符合实际业务需求,极易引发CPU资源瓶颈。常见问题包括处理器核心分配不足、内存设置不合理以及存储空间配置不当。

  • 处理器配置:在单个处理器上运行耗时操作会导致电路滞后,而多线程操作可能耗尽所有处理能力。
  • 内存配置:虚拟主机缓存进程过多或活动线程移动到存储中,都会造成内存过度使用。
  • 存储配置:为虚拟主机分配单一数据存储会使SSD负担过重,大量读/写操作导致性能下降。

系统级优化与监控策略

建立完善的监控体系是预防和解决CPU性能问题的关键。通过阿里云虚拟主机管理页面,用户可以实时查看CPU使用率情况,并在监控信息区域定位到CPU满载的具体时间点。

通过按来源IP统计功能,管理员可以精确定位连接数过高的IP地址或IP网段,从而识别异常访问行为。这种细粒度的监控能力为解决CPU性能问题提供了重要数据支持。

可以考虑使用CDN加速服务,将网站内容缓存到全球各地节点,有效减轻源服务器的CPU负载压力。定期进行服务器维护和优化,包括清理无用文件、更新系统补丁、优化数据库查询等操作,都能显著提升服务器性能和稳定性。

长期性能维护与资源规划

对于长期运行的业务系统,仅仅解决眼前的CPU性能问题是不够的,还需要建立系统性的资源规划机制。

在云计算环境中,适度的虚拟机迁移能降低数据中心能耗,但过度迁移会造成系统性能降低。研究表明,对于Web应用服务,由虚拟机迁移导致的开销约占其CPU利用率的10%。

最佳实践建议:

  • 设置合理的资源使用阈值,当CPU使用率超过85%时及时采取干预措施。

  • 采用基于三阈值的虚拟机迁移算法(TESA),根据不同负载状态采取差异化策略。

  • 定期评估业务增长趋势,提前规划资源扩容方案。

通过以上系统性分析和针对性解决方案,用户可以有效地应对阿里云虚拟主机CPU性能受限问题,确保业务稳定运行和服务质量。

内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。

本文由星速云发布。发布者:星速云。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/71021.html

(0)
上一篇 2025年11月17日 下午3:53
下一篇 2025年11月17日 下午3:53
联系我们
关注微信
关注微信
分享本页
返回顶部